Skip to main contentLoading IP information... 183.224.0.0/15 - IP Address Lookup | IpToolsKit183.225.16.202
🇨🇳Kunming, Yunnan, China
183.224.125.31
🇨🇳Kunming, Yunnan, China
183.225.119.175
🇨🇳Kunming, Yunnan, China
183.224.98.192
🇨🇳Kunming, Yunnan, China
183.225.96.137
🇨🇳Kunming, Yunnan, China
183.224.63.187
🇨🇳Kunming, Yunnan, China
183.224.213.180
🇨🇳Kunming, Yunnan, China
183.225.134.140
🇨🇳Kunming, Yunnan, China